How to get drawing, mockups, etc, when you're not an artist...

I just had this idea tonight. A lot of times people are looking for help with a drawing or sketch of their product. If you've heard of fiverr.com, that might be a good idea to get some artwork done. Of course I would encourage everyone to utilize the skills of the people here in our community. But if you need outside help, fiverr and other similar sites are a good place to try.
